Summary

The Area Sales Manager role is to expand our customer base and achieve sales quotas for specific regions of our company. Area Sales Managers are professionals who manage and coach/mentor team members to accomplish sales objectives across many different regions. This position can control significant decisions, recruit new customers, and increase sales by improving employee engagement techniques. 

 
To be successful in this role, you should have previous experience managing the operation of a specific region while taking accountability for reaching targets. Must combine excellent communication skills, leadership, organization/planning capabilities and decision-making/critical thinking skills. 

What You'll Do

 

 

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Coaches, mentors and develops the sales team
  • Set and manage individual and team sales goals
  • Implements policies and procedures designed to exceed customer expectations
  • Coordinates activities with Sales, Operations and Production Department
  • Conducts or participates in annual performance reviews for sales team members
  • Manages resolution of customer related issues efficiently and effectively
  • Assist in the recruiting, hiring, training and coaching of new factory representatives
  • Keep informed of competitor activity including manufacturers utilized and pricing related information
  • Creatively utilize sales contests to build morale and motivate the sales team.
  • Work with Inside Sales Manager to ensure the showroom is covered at all times and that walk-in customers are being handled timely and efficiently
  • Communicate effectively with senior management to ensure that sales goals and sales performance are aligned with company directives
  • Ensure high levels of customer satisfaction

On March 28, 2024, PGT Innovations was successfully acquired by MITER Brands and incorporated into the organization’s portfolio. MITER Brands is a family of leading window and door brands united by a passion for quality and relentless pursuit of 100%.
